Manthrakodi is a 1972 Indian Malayalam film, directed by M. Krishnan Nair and produced by R. M. Veerappan. The film stars Prem Nazir, Vijayasree, Kaviyoor Ponnamma and Adoor Bhasi in the lead roles. The film had musical score by M. S. Viswanathan.[1][2][3] It is a remake of Tamil film Deiva Thai.

Soundtrack

The music was composed by M. S. Viswanathan and the lyrics were written by Sreekumaran Thampi.

No. Song Singers Lyrics Length (m:ss)
1 "Aadi Varunnu" L. R. Eeswari Sreekumaran Thampi
2 "Arabikkadalilakivarunnu" P. Jayachandran, Chorus Sreekumaran Thampi
3 "Kathirmandapamorukki" P. Susheela Sreekumaran Thampi
4 "Kilukkaathe Kilungunna" P. Susheela, P. Jayachandran Sreekumaran Thampi
5 "Malarambanezhuthiya" P. Jayachandran Sreekumaran Thampi
